US/Silver Spring: World Variety Produce, Inc.., a Los Angeles, California establishment, recalls certain batch/lots of Melissa’s Kimchi Hot from the American marketplace due to suspected mislabeling and consequential improperly declared Fish, a known allergen, source of dietary intolerance and possible trigger of Anaphylaxis, a serious and potential fatal situation, requiring immediate medical intervention to minimize pain and suffering as well as prevent life-altering injury or death.
